We will dissect the intricacies of Florida's laws, examine recent trends, and provide actionable insights for those facing these charges. 🧠 🔍 What Constitutes a Repeat DUI Offense in Florida? In the Sunshine State, a repeat DUI offense is defined by the number of times an individual is found guilty of driving under the influence within a specified timeframe.
